On Sat, 20 Sep 2014 09:29:31 -0400
RJ Ryan <russelljr...@gmail.com> wrote:

> Using libc++ unfortunately bumps us up to minimum of Mac OS X 10.7.
>
> Mixxx 1.12.0 will support ancient platforms (XP, OS X 10.5 / 10.6) so we're
> not ready to do this yet.

> > I broke the OSX build in way that I currently can't fix in scons. The
> > problem is
> > that the dependencies on OSX are not build against the libc++
> > implementation I
> > would like to use.
> >
> > I want to use the llvm implementation of the standard C++ library on OSX
> > because
> > it is up to date. The standart GNU libstdc++ is only included in a version
> > below
> > 4.2, which does not support C++11, due to licencing issues. See:
> >
> > http://libcxx.llvm.org/
> >
> > But we need a C++ Libray that supports C++11 to use 'cstdint' for integer
> > type
> > definitions across platforms. So if you can update our dependencies on the
> > build
> > server to use libc++ as well the build should be fixed again.
> >
> > There are also other ways to solve this but it would involve using 'ifdef
> > __MAC__'
> > and libraries where I'm not sure if the support is not removed at some
> > point
> > in the future.
